This is the continuation of Prem's work [1]. This v5 mainly brings VFIO integration in DT mode. On guest kernel side, this requires a quirk [1] to force TLB invalidation on map. The following changes also are noticeable: - fix SMMU_CMDQ_CONS offset - adds dma-coherent dt property which fixes the unhandled command opcode bug. - implements block PTE The smmu is instantiated when passing the smmu option to machvirt: "-M virt-2.10,smmu" As I haven't split the code yet so that it can be easily reviewable I don't expect deep reviews at this stage. Also the implementation may be largely sub-optimal. Tested Use Cases: - booted a guest in dt and acpi mode with an iommu_platform virtio-net-pci device (using dma ops). Tested with the following guest combinations: 4K page - 39 bit VA, 4K - 48b, 64K - 39b, 64K - 48b. - booted a guest (featuring [1]) with PCIe passthrough'ed PCIe devices: - AMD Overdrive and igbvf passthrough (using gsi direct mapping) - Cavium ThunderX and ixgbevf passthrough (using KVM MSI routing) Unfortunately I have not been able to run DPDK testpmd yet on guest side. The problem I see is the user space driver dma-maps a huge area and this causes plenty of CMDQ_OP_TLBI_NH_VA commands to be sent (tlbi-on-map) which are sent for each page whereas the dma-map covers a huge page. I will work on this issue for next version. Known limitations: - no VMSAv8-32 suport - no nested stage support (S1 + S2) - no support for HYP mappings - register fine emulation, commands, interrupts and errors were not accurately tested. Handling is sufficient to run use cases described hereafter though.
